Dillinger is a sweet young man around 4 years old who is ready to find his furever home. He was brought to the shelter as a stray in early April and upon intake tested positive for FIV. Dillinger would be much safer as the only cat in the home or with other cats with FIV. This sweet boy just loves attention, and he will purr very loud to show you that he enjoys it. He loves to walk through your legs and under your hands, pushing every part of his body against yours in hopes he will get pet, scratched or just loved up on in any way. Dillinger makes very expressive faces, like sticking out his tongue! He also has the most perfect placement of the black and white coloring all around his body that give him a very special look. His eyes are very bright and bold yellow-green and with his signature left ear tip, Dillinger is a very unique looking boy!
